When mounting a shared drive in VirtualBox 4.3.10, got he following error in Linux box: sudo mount -t vboxsf E_DRIVE vbox mount: wrong fs type, bad option, bad superblock on E_DRIVE, missing codepage or helper program, or other error (for several filesystems (e.g. nfs, cifs) you might need a /sbin/mount.<type> helper program) In some cases useful info is found in syslog - try dmesg | tail or so This is caused by wrong symbolic link, to fix it do: ~$ sudo ln -sf /usr/lib/i386-linux-gnu/VBoxGuestAdditions/mount.vboxsf /sbin/mount.vboxsf References: http://superuser.com/questions/736024/cannot-share-host-directory-with-virtualbox-guest-mint-16-64-bit
